Acupuncture: How This Holistic Health Technique Helps Ease Aches & Pains by Mindy Hudon, M.S., CCC-SLP
For my family, I seek alternative medicine before traditional methods and medications for non-life threatening conditions like aches and pains. Through the years, I've experienced minor injuries that are more annoying than debilitating. Recently, I started receiving acupuncture.
Acupuncture is so relaxing! My qualified practitioner gently places thin, sterilized needles in my body to relieve my specific pain. As tranquil music plays in the background, I lay quietly under warm lights. It eases my pain so I can function better. Best of all, there are no side effects!
